The Evolution of Online Gaming:

Online gaming traces its roots back to the early days of computer networking, with pioneers like ARPANET laying the groundwork for multiplayer experiences. As technology advanced, the emergence of dial-up internet in the 1990s paved the way for the first online multiplayer games, such as MUDs (Multi-User Dungeons) and early online shooters like Doom. Best GAP Insurance in the UK: A Guide to Protecting Your Vehicle Investment

When purchasing a car, one of the most important aspects of financial protection is securing the right insurance. While most people focus on standard car insurance, an often-overlooked option is Guaranteed Asset Protection (GAP) insurance. GAP insurance is a valuable policy designed to cover the difference between the market value of your car and what you owe on your finance or lease agreement. If your car is written off or stolen, GAP insurance can save you from being left with a significant financial shortfall. Here’s a guide to the best GAP insurance options available in the UK.

What is GAP Insurance?

GAP insurance ensures that if your car is written off or stolen, the insurer’s payout will cover the amount you owe on your finance agreement or lease. Since cars depreciate rapidly, the market best gap insurance uk value can be much lower than the amount you still owe. GAP insurance helps cover this difference, providing you with financial protection.

Why Do You Need GAP Insurance?

  1. Depreciation: A new car loses value as soon as it leaves the showroom, and the depreciation continues rapidly during the first few years. If you finance or lease your car, there’s a risk that the insurance payout will not be enough to clear your outstanding balance.

  2. Car Finance and Leasing: Many UK drivers buy their vehicles on finance or lease, meaning they still owe money on the car even if it’s written off. GAP insurance ensures you’re not left paying for a car you no longer have.

  3. Peace of Mind: GAP insurance offers peace of mind, knowing you won’t be financially burdened if your car is lost or damaged beyond repair.

Modding Your PC Case: A Beginner’s Guide to Case Customization

A computer case, often referred to as a chassis or tower, is a crucial component in any computer build, providing both practical and aesthetic benefits. It serves as the housing for various internal components such as the motherboard, central processing unit (CPU), storage devices, power supply unit (PSU), and cooling systems. While seemingly just a protective shell, the design and functionality of a computer case play a significant role in the overall performance, longevity, and visual appeal of the system.

One of the primary functions of a computer Tech Accessories for Gamers case is to protect the delicate internal hardware from external damage. It shields the components from dust, moisture, and physical impacts, ensuring that the system operates smoothly and without interruption. Additionally, cases come equipped with mounting points and secure fasteners, holding the parts in place and preventing them from shifting or vibrating during use.

Ventilation and airflow are essential considerations when selecting a computer case. As modern computer components generate substantial heat, effective cooling is vital to prevent overheating and to extend the life of the hardware. Many cases are designed with airflow in mind, featuring strategically placed vents, mesh panels, and fan mounts. Some even include additional cooling options like liquid cooling setups or pre-installed fans to enhance the system’s thermal performance. A well-ventilated case helps maintain optimal temperatures, ensuring that the system runs at peak efficiency.

Aesthetic appeal is another key factor influencing the choice of computer case. With the rise of custom builds and gaming PCs, many users seek cases that reflect their personal style. Computer cases now come in a wide range of designs, from sleek, minimalist enclosures to more elaborate models with RGB lighting, tempered glass panels, and unique shapes. These design elements not only enhance the visual appeal but can also serve as a statement of individuality. The trend toward transparent side panels has allowed users to showcase their hardware, turning the internal components into an art form.

Another important consideration is the case’s compatibility with various hardware. Depending on the size of the motherboard and the number of components, users must choose cases that can accommodate the specific parts they wish to use. For example, cases come in different form factors like full tower, mid-tower, and mini-ITX, each offering different levels of space and expansion options. Ensuring proper compatibility helps avoid frustrations during the assembly process and ensures that there’s enough room for future upgrades.
